Naylor, Georgia (GA) Poverty Rate Data
Information about poor and low-income residents
10.5% of Naylor, GA residents had an income below the poverty level in 2022, which was 20.6% less than the poverty level of 12.7% across the entire state of Georgia. Taking into account residents not living in families, 12.4% of high school graduates and 36.2% of non high school graduates live in poverty. The poverty rate was 9.3% among disabled males and 23.3% among disabled females. The renting rate among poor residents was 18.8%. For comparison, it was 11.4% among residents with income above the poverty level.
